A 24-year-old man was identified as the murder suspect in the death of a woman shot in an El Paso desert.

Karina Isabel Tobias, 21, was shot in the desert area near the 14400 block of Montwood Drive on April 10.

Tobias was taken to the hospital with life-threatening injuries.

Days later, authorities stated that the El Paso County Sheriff’s Office was informed that Tobias had died of her injuries.

El Paso County Sheriff's investigators secured an arrest warrant charging Efrain Orozco with the victim's murder.

Orozco was taken into custody and booked into the El Paso County Detention Facility under a $500,000.00 bond.
